One thing at a time

September 17, 2018 by Paddy Spruce

Tweet

Of course, we all do more than one thing at a time. For example, we can text and cross the road or text and drive a car. But the question is can we do two things with full attention at the same time. Probably not according to road statistics. Jumping from one task to another means that your attention is divided for a few moments and you lose your train of thought.

Doing one thing at a time is a good habit. Do everything you do with full attention. It can become a very helpful habit. Remember the old clock makers or today’s tennis players. It doesn’t matter what you are doing.It’s how much attention you give to what you are doing.

Try it next time you cook, drive, cross the road or brush your teeth. Maybe also next time you speak to a group or audience.
